Solid elements hold heat longer than
conventional surface units. For best
cooking results, use a high setting for
only a short period of time. Then use a
lower setting to complete the cooking.
You may want to turn the solid element
surface unit OFF a few minutes before
you finish cooking.

Cookware
Pans should be the same size or larger
than the surface umt to prevent boil-
overs and hot handles.
Use only flat-bottomed utensils. Flat
bottoms allow maximum contact
between the pans and surface units for
fast, even cooking. Pans with uneven
bottoms or with raised patterns on the
bottoms are not suitable. Do not use
trivets, woks with skirts, or canners
with concave or ridged bottoms.
To check your cookware for flatness,
place a straight-edge across the bottom
of each piece. Rotate the straight-edge
across the bottom. If light shows
anywhere between the pan and the
straight-edge, the pan is not flat. Do not
use it.

Bum And Product Damage Hazard
.If the pan is too small for the
surface unit, you could be burned
by the heat from the exposed
section of the surface unit. Use
correctly sized cooking utensils to
prevent injury.
. If a surface unit stays red for a long
time, the bottom of the pan is not
flat enough or is too small for the
surface unit. Prolonged usage of
incorrect utensils for long periods
of time can result in damage to the
surface unit, cooktop, wiring and
surrounding areas. To prevent
damage, use correct utensils, start
cooking on high setting and turn
control down to continue cooking.

To set the automatic stop timer:
1. Set the Time Bake Switch to TIME
BAKE. The TIME BAKE Signal
Light will light.
2. Turn the Oven Temp Control to the
desired oven temperature.
3. Push the Set Button twice. A beep
will sound with each push and a
bell will light on the face of the
clock along with the word “AUTO”
4. Turn the Clock/Timer Knob to the
desired cook time up to 9 hours 50
minutes.
NOTE: Knob must be turned within 15
seconds after button is pushed.
The oven will turn on within the next
30-40 seconds and will turn off
automatically at the end of the set cook
time.
To check time-of-day during cooking:
. Push the Set Button once. A beep
will sound and the time-of-day will
be displayed.
To return to the cook time display:
. Push the Set Button once. A beep
will sound and the automatic cook
time will reappear.
